Vermont is full of rail yards and defunct infrastructure left over from the golden age of the New England railroads. This particular yard is quite close to downtown Burlington and is still in active use, visited by freight trains on the line north to Quebec.
On the left is a hemispherical set of locomotive garages and a spinning black platform used to point locomotives at the appropriate doorway. On the right is a track full of spare metal wheels.
